Book Review #11 - Who will cry when you die?

 


Book : Who will cry when you die?

Author : Robin Sharma

Short Blurb:

The book offers 101 simple solutions to life’s most frustrating challenges, to recreate your life so that you feel strikingly happy, beautifully fulfilled and deeply peaceful.

🌟What is my take on this?

This is my second novel written by Robin Sharma. It has many insights, thoughts, guidelines for the betterment, self-improvement and self-reflection. This book can be carried along, to refer to, at times when you need inspiration and motivation to go on. It will fill you with determination.

If you read this novel, you will be filled with bountiful of good hopes and energy.

🌟What are my thoughts on the title and cover?

The cover is thoughtful and the title is perplexing with a hint of philosophy.

🌟What'd be one thing that’s most captivating?

It's pragmatic and nudges the reader to actually rethink about the challenges and circumstances in life. It's simple - either you see a glass hall full or half empty, it's up to how you nurture your mind and your life.

It is highly recommended if you're looking for self-improvement, inspiration and seeking the purpose of life.
